Robot vs. robot: which knee surgery tool works best?
NCT ID NCT07555067
First seen Apr 29, 2026 · Last updated May 09, 2026 · Updated 2 times
Summary
This study compares two robotic systems (Velys J&J and Cori S&N) used in total knee replacement surgery. It involves 200 adults with severe knee arthritis. The goal is to see which robot helps achieve better knee alignment and movement after surgery.
